Find a Teacher is italki's "search engine" for students looking for language teachers. Most students find their teacher on italki using "Find a Teacher".
Search filters
At the top of the page, students can filter the thousands of teachers on italki by categories like Language to learn, teachers from a specific country, other languages the teacher speaks, price, etc. Make sure your information is updated and accurate so that the filters will apply to you correctly.
Once the students have applied search filters, italki sorts the matching teachers into a list.
Search results
"Find a Teacher" results are listed is sorted according to teachers' recent activities. This means that teachers who recently logged in or were active on the site will show up higher on the list for each student.
When students see you on the list, they will see your picture, basic information, a brief introduction, and tags. Choose information that will help students quickly understand whether they are your ideal student.
Where am I on the list?
The list updates once every 10 minutes, so if you've just logged in, you might not see yourself on the list until the next update. If you don't see yourself on the list, please wait 10-15 minutes and then look again.
Note: If you are looking at the iOS app, then you will not be able to find yourself on the list, as the iOS app automatically "removes" your own profile. You will need to log out and then go to italki.com/teachers in order to view yourself on the list.
If you have set your Availability Statues to "Not looking for new students", then you will not appear on the Teacher List. Here is how to find and check your Availability Status.
When you are ready to accept new students again, you can just update your "Availability Status" to "looking for new students", and you will appear on the Teacher List again.
How do I move up the list?
In general, teachers who are more active on italki will appear higher.
Please DO NOT use any automatic page refreshers or any artificial way of exaggerating your activity on the website. This is a misrepresentation of your real activity and is considered a violation of italki teacher Code of Conduct.
Teachers that are using auto-refresh tools or are constantly refreshing will be removed from the teacher search, possibly for a week or more.
